Choose ointments when you purchase a moisturizer. They can help soothe eczema because they create an added layer of protection. Creams and lotions don’t do not hold in moisture like ointments do. This makes ointments much better in areas where eczema has open cracks because of eczema.

A warm bath can relieve the itching associated with eczema. Do not make the bath water too cold or too hot. You may experience some relief using baking soda or even oatmeal at bath time. One other option is adding 4 ounces of bleach to an average 40-gallon bath tub of water to eliminate any bacteria that may be on your skin.

Moisturize the eczema when the skin is moist. This is when the skin takes the moisturizer in to help soothe it. Begin blotting the skin lightly with a cotton towel to get it to moist but not wet. Apply your moisturizer at this time. Do this quickly after you bathe to keep skin moisturized.

You should install a new humidifier if you are losing the battle to eczema. Especially when it’s the winter time, the air is dry which makes your skin dry. This may make your eczema act up. Humidifiers put extra moisture into the room, keeping skin free from the dryness of an eczema flare.

Do not give into the temptation of a really hot shower or bath. While a hot shower can feel wonderful, it can lead to skin irritations. If you have eczema, try to limit the amount of hot showers you take. Use a gentle cleaner and always moisturize immediately afterward.
